Slate roof repair services involve inspecting, maintaining, and restoring slate roofing systems to ensure their durability and appearance. These services typically include replacing damaged or missing slate tiles, fixing underlying support structures, sealing leaks, and addressing issues caused by weathering or aging.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the slate, identify areas at risk of deterioration, and perform targeted repairs to extend the roof’s lifespan. Proper maintenance helps preserve the natural beauty of slate roofs while preventing more costly problems down the line.

Slate roofs can develop a variety of problems over time, such as cracked or broken tiles, loose slates, and leaks. These issues often arise from weather exposure, temperature fluctuations, or physical impacts like falling debris. When water seeps through damaged tiles, it can lead to water intrusion, mold growth, and damage to the underlying roof deck. Addressing these problems early with professional repairs can prevent further deterioration, protect the interior of the property, and maintain the roof’s structural integrity.

Properties that commonly use slate roofing include historic homes, upscale residences, and buildings with distinctive architectural styles that emphasize natural materials. Slate is valued for its long-lasting qualities and aesthetic appeal, making it a popular choice in neighborhoods with a focus on craftsmanship and design. Commercial buildings and institutional properties may also have slate roofs, especially when historic preservation or architectural authenticity is a priority. The overview below groups typical Slate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Maple Valley,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or slate roof repairs, such as replacing a few broken slates or fixing small leaks,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.

Moderate Repairs - More extensive repairs, including partial replacements or addressing multiple damaged areas, often c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are common for homeowners needing significant repairs but not a full roof overhaul.

Full Roof Replacement - Replacing an entire slate roof usually costs between $10,000-$30,000, depending on the size of the roof and complexity of the installation. Larger, more intricate projects can exceed this range, but many replacements fall into the middle of this spectrum.

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more complex projects such as complete roof overhauls or custom installations can reach $30,000+ in costs. These tend to be less frequent but are necessary for extensive damage or historic restoration work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a slate roof needs repair? Visible cracked, broken, or missing slate tiles, water stains on ceilings, and increased energy bills can indicate roof damage requiring attention from local contractors.

Can slate roofs be repaired without replacing entire sections? Yes, many issues such as cracked or loose tiles can often be fixed through targeted repairs performed by experienced local service providers.

What types of repairs do local contractors typically handle for slate roofs? They commonly address cracked or broken tiles, loose slate, flashing issues, and minor leaks to restore roof integrity and prevent further damage.

Are there specific maintenance tasks to keep a slate roof in good condition? Regular inspections for damaged tiles, clearing debris, and prompt repairs of any cracks or loose slates help maintain the roof’s longevity.
